20 Minutes is Enough:
Work got crazy.
Deadlines piling up. Late nights. No time.
So training goes on pause.
"I'll get back to it next week."
And next week becomes next month.
Here's the fix most guys never consider:
You don't need to maintain your full program during a brutal stretch at work.
You just need to stay in the game.
Cut your sessions back to 3 times 20 minutes per week.
One hour a week total.
That's it.
You can get a ton of quality work done in just one hour a week - and still have the energy left over that you need to get the rest of life done.
The goal during a crazy season isn't progress.
It's not losing ground.
20 minutes keeps your technique sharp.
20 minutes keeps your nervous system trained.
20 minutes keeps the habit alive so you're not starting from zero when work calms down.
The guys who stay consistent over years aren't the ones who train perfectly when life is perfect.
They're the ones who know how to scale back without quitting entirely.
A reduced program beats a paused one every single time.
